Post by: Allenm on 23 October 2007, 08:30:13
The mileage rate you get is whatever the company decides to pay, it has nothing to do with the IR rates.

At the end of the year, if you have used your own car for business purposes, you can then claim the tax back on the difference (See for IR125 on the HMRC website).  its 40p for the first 10,000 miles then 25p thereafter.  You don't get back the difference, just the tax on the difference, but if you do loads of miles you can be quids in!
